Output 159e03689e5adfea1d8bd11cc75d224daefd1b230b754875b78a8bb6f00a06d6:1

value
7789501
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 443ca76f6bf169cfc0c0a82c4c854e1b40fd1c7a OP_EQUALVERIFY OP_CHECKSIG
address
17DocMxV86LWLwRjHY4bxBdDNaJ3AJcRwZ
transaction
159e03689e5adfea1d8bd11cc75d224daefd1b230b754875b78a8bb6f00a06d6
confirmations
459277
spent
true